“Blasphemous” social media image of Donald Trump deleted

Published 1 month, 3 weeks ago
Description

President Trump posted an image Sunday evening on Truth Social depicting himself that many across the political spectrum protested as sacrilegious. One writer called the post “blasphemous” and “reprehensible.” Conservative pundit Carmine Sabia stated, “As a Christian, I’m offended by this, and I don’t know how any Christian would not be offended by this. There is only one Lord and Savior Jesus Christ. Mocking him is not OK.” Though the post has now been deleted, its caption claimed, “America has been sick for a long time. President Trump is healing this nation.” No, he’s not. But not for the reasons you might think.
